The Talent Myth: Why You Don't Need to Be an Actor
There is a little red light on the front of every camera. It is smaller than a penny, but for many business owners, it is the most terrifying object in the world.
I have seen brilliant trial lawyers freeze when that light turns on. I have seen CEOs who command boardrooms of 500 people suddenly forget their own names.
The fear stems from a single myth: "I need to perform." You think you need to be charismatic like Tony Robbins or polished like a CNN anchor. You think you need "talent."
But here is the liberating truth: Your clients do not want an actor. They want an expert.
Perfection is Suspicious
In 2025, we have reached "Peak Polish." We are flooded with filtered, scripted, AI-generated perfection. Because of this, we have developed an allergy to it. When we see someone who is too smooth, we assume they are selling us something.
Authenticity is the new currency. A pause while you think, a stumble over a word, a genuine laugh—these are not mistakes. They are proof of humanity.
Your "awkwardness" is actually your greatest asset, because it proves you are real.
